County Courthouse
Tate County Courthouse
201 Ward St;
Senatobia, MS 38668
Phone: 662.562.5661
Clerk Circuit Court has marriage records from 1873.
Clerk Chancery Court has divorce, probate, court, and land records from 1873. [1]
History
Parent County
1873--Tate County was created 15 April 1873 from Marshall, Tunica and DeSoto Counties.
County seat: Senatobia [2]
